Plan - correct answer To apply the art & science of understanding a situation, envisioning a desired future & laying out effective ways of bringing that future about Assess - correct answer To continuously check the progress toward accomplishing a task or achieving an objective Prepare - correct answer To make ready those activities by units & soldiers to improve their abilities to train for an operation Execute - correct answer To put a plan into action by training units & individuals to accomplish the mission Plan, Prepare, Execute, Assess - correct answer 4 activities of the operations process Military decision making process (MDMP) - correct answer The army's operation planning method used for commands with a coordinating staff (typically battallion and higher) Troop Leading Procedures (TLP) - correct answer The Army's operations planning and execution process for units without a coordinating staff (typically company and platoon)

  1. Receive the Mission
  2. Issue a warning order
  3. Make a tentative plan
  4. Initiate movement
  5. Conduct reconnaissance
  6. Complete the plan
  7. Issue the order
  8. Supervise and refine the plan - correct answer Troop Leading Procedures

probability - correct answer The likelihood that an event will occur Frequent, likely, occasional, seldom, unlikely - correct answer The five degrees of probability Severity - correct answer Approximate amount of potential harm, damage, or injury associated with a given mishap occurring Catastrophic, critical, moderate, negligible - correct answer The four degrees of severity Risk level - correct answer Estimating risk follows from examining the outcomes of both the probability and severity of hazardous incidents Extremely high, high, moderate, low - correct answer Four levels of risk Extremely high - correct answer Risk level-loss of ability to accomplish the mission if hazard occurs during mission High - correct answer Risk level-Significant degradation of mission capabilities in terms of the required mission standard Moderate - correct answer Risk level-Expected degraded mission capabilities in terms of the required mission standard Low - correct answer Risk level-expected losses have little or no impact on accomplishment of mission Identify hazards, assess hazards, develop controls, implement controls, supervise & evaluate - correct answer What are the steps in risk management process?
